What is Injury Law?
Injury law, frequently described as Tort Law, includes a wide variety of legal disputes that develop when a single person's negligence leads to harm to another. This includes physical injuries, emotional distress, and even monetary losses. The main objective in these cases is to achieve compensation for the injured party.

The length of time do I need to file a lawsuit?
Each state has its own statute of restrictions for personal injury cases. Usually, this varies from one to 3 years from the date of the occurrence. Seeking legal advice promptly is vital to guarantee you do not miss crucial deadlines.
